Woman ends life
Staff Reporter
BANGALORE: A 38-year-old woman committed suicide by hanging herself from a ceiling fan at her house in Gurudutt Layout in Vidyaranyapura police station limits on Friday. The police said Meera Bai’s husband Velu had an accident two years ago and was bedridden. After that, she began to work as a maid. On Friday, she went inside a room and did not come out even after a long time. Velu called neighbours and when the door was opened, Meera Bai was found hanging from the ceiling fan.
Doctors arrested
The Madiwala police arrested four doctors for allegedly causing injury to two persons who had come to the hospital on September 22. The police have arrested Anil Biradar, Amit Biradar, Dayanand R. and G.S. Raghu of Popular Nursing Home at Garvebhavipalya.
The accused had a fight with Radhakrishna and Nagaraj over treatment to a child. Radhakrishna and Nagaraj were attacked with scissors, the police said.
